Piratkopieringsseminar 2023

Date: November 9th
Time: 08.30 - 12.45
Location: Lundgrens Advokatpartnerselskab, Tuborg Boulevard 12, 4. sal 2900 Hellerup, Denmark

Event organized by Lundgrens.

This year, the seminar focuses on both classic and new themes within intellectual property rights infringement and enforcement. We are emphasizing the customs and criminal enforcement efforts to combat IPR crime, receiving an analysis from the academic world on the development in the assessment of damages for IPR infringements, gaining insight into how three companies are working to combat counterfeit goods, and finally, focusing on infringements of IP rights as part of AI training.

There will be ample opportunity to ask questions to the speakers.

The seminar is organized in collaboration between the Danish Patent and Trademark Office, the Ministry of Culture, the Confederation of Danish Industry, and the Danish Anti-Counterfeiting Group (DACG). The seminar is also co-financed by EUIPO (the European Union Intellectual Property Office).

This event is FREE.
